Prescott Journal Miner, Prescott, Yavapai, Arizona Territory
Sunday, October 2, 1910, page 5, column 3
Laurence Martin Dies Of Heart Disease
Laurence Martin, for over a year a resident of this county, and a
wood chopper by occupation, passed away yesterday morning at the
county hospital, from heart disease, from which he had suffered from
since last February, when he entered that institution.
He was aged 62 years, and was a native of Canada. His only known
relative is Thomas Martin of Jerome, a brother. He was an
industrious man and bore an exemplary name.
Transcriber's note: Mr. Martin is buried in an unmarked grave at the
Citizens Cemetery in Prescott, Arizona.
It is unclear if his given name is spelled Lawrence or Laurence.
